  • Nuclear Waste Services is a c£250m / 1000 FTE organisation but is expected to grow substantially in the Medium / Long term as the mission progresses. Within Major Capital Projects, the Geological Disposal Facility alone is a £20-£53 billion 100-plus year project which will be one of the biggest infrastructure and environmental protection programmes in the UK.
